-// UDPSocket |
-// Accessor API for a UDP socket in either client or server form. |
-// |
-// Client form: |
-// In this case, we're connecting to a specific server, so the client will |
-// usually use: |
-// Open(address_family) // Open a socket. |
-// Connect(address) // Connect to a UDP server |
-// Read/Write // Reads/Writes all go to a single destination |
-// |
-// Server form: |
-// In this case, we want to read/write to many clients which are connecting |
-// to this server. First the server 'binds' to an addres, then we read from |
-// clients and write responses to them. |
-// Example: |
-// Open(address_family) // Open a socket. |
-// Bind(address/port) // Binds to port for reading from clients |
-// RecvFrom/SendTo // Each read can come from a different client |
-// // Writes need to be directed to a specific |
-// // address. |
-#if defined(OS_WIN) |
-typedef UDPSocketWin UDPSocket; |
-#elif defined(OS_POSIX) |
-typedef UDPSocketPosix UDPSocket; |
-#endif |
